Arlington's real estate market is solid, benefiting from being smack between Dallas and Fort Worth in the thriving DFW metroplex. Home prices have risen in Arlington in recent years, but they remain more affordable than Dallas's hottest areas.
That value factor makes Arlington a popular pick for families and buyers seeking more bang for their buck in DFW. The city saw a share of the recent housing boom, with quick sales and higher prices, but it wasn't as crazy as what happened in some big-city frenzies.
Now, with higher interest rates, Arlington's market has cooled slightly. Buyers have a bit more breathing room than when every listing got immediate attention. Still, good houses especially those in nice subdivisions or near Arlington's big attractions (the stadiums, parks, etc.) continue to find eager buyers.
Sellers might not get a dozen offers on day one anymore, but well-priced homes are still selling in a reasonable time. Foreclosure listings in Arlington are rare; the steady growth and strong economy in the area have kept distress sales minimal. All in all, Arlington remains a dependable, middle-of-it-all market offering suburban space, relatively reasonable prices, and the perks of the booming region around it.
